Evansville Purple Aces Betting Preview
The Evansville Purple Aces enter Thursday’s game with a 4–10 win-loss record, including an 0–3 mark in conference play and an 0–5 record on the road this season. The Purple Aces have compiled wins over Ball State and the Oregon State Beavers, while losing games to Bradley, Drake, SMU, Notre Dame and the Akron Zips. More recently, in the Evansville Purple Aces 76–68 loss to the Bradley Braves, Evansville forward AJ Casey tallied 21 points (8 of 14 shooting from the field), 4 rebounds, 1 assist, and 1 steal, showcasing his ability to lead the Purple Aces frontcourt.
The Evansville Purple Aces average 66.8 points on 40.5 percent shooting from the field and 29.9 percent shooting from behind the arc per game. On the defensive side of the basketball, the Purple Aces are allowing opponents 77.2 points per contest.
Senior forward Connor Turnbill leads the Evansville Purple Aces frontcourt averaging 13.3 points, 6.5 rebounds and 1.3 assists and 2.8 blocks per game. Junior forward Joshua Hughes averages 9.4 points, 5.4 rebounds and 1 assist per contest, while freshman guard Leif Moeller provides additional scoring depth contributing 7.7 points per game.
Illinois State Redbirds Betting Preview
The Illinois State Redbirds enter Thursday’s contest with an 11–3 record, including a 6–0 record at home. The Redbirds have amassed wins over Indiana State, Southern Illinois, Chicago State, Coastal Carolina and the Charlotte 49ers, while losing games to Utah State, USC and the Ohio Bobcats. In the Illinois State Redbirds 93–48 blowout victory over the Rockford Regents two days ago, Illinois State forward Brandon Lieb amassed 10 points, 10 rebounds, and 1 assist in only 16 minutes of play.The Illinois State Redbirds average 79.5 points on 48.9 percent shooting from the field (41st in the country) and 36 percent shooting from three‑point range per game. Defensively, the Redbirds are allowing opponents 67.9 points per game which ranks 47th in the nation.
Junior forward Chase Walker leads the Illinois State Redbirds averaging 12.7 points, 5.2 rebounds and 2.7 assists per game. Junior guard Johnny Kinziger adds 12.4 points, 2.9 rebounds, and 2.6 assists per contest. Senior forward Brandon Lieb provides further frontcourt versatility for the Redbirds, averaging 4.2 points and 5.2 rebounds per contest.
